Adventure Teens focuses on a more developmental programme.
There will be 2 days of Bushcraft looking at fire lighting, campfire cooking and shelter building. We'll be developing skills from the first day and then setting challenges to complete on the second day.
You'll also be completing 2 days of paddle sports. Day 1 will be focused on skills & technique. The second day will be going on a day journey e.g. Old Harry Rocks from Studland Bay.
There will also be a day of Coasteering or Climbing. (weather dependant).
Day 1 – Advanced Bushcraft: Knife Skills and Fire lighting
Day 2 – Campfire Cookery, Axe throwing
Day 3 – Paddle Extravaganza and Jumbo Paddle boarding
Day 4 - Kayak to Old Harry
Day 5 – Coasteering

KIDS CLUB
SUMMER This is an outdoor-based Kids Club, so we choose the best and safest activities for the weather conditions.
A typical week usually includes: Watersports at Sandbanks (Kayaking, Paddle boarding, Raft Building, Crabbing, Beach Games), Bushcraft in the woods (fire lighting, campfire cooking, archery) and Coasteering on the Jurassic Coast (weather dependant).
AUTUMN We head to the woods for 3 days. We'll pick up the children from Sandbanks by minibus and head to a different beautiful private woodland each day. The plan is a Zombie Archery Day, a Pumpkin Carving and Fire Lighting Day and a Halloween Fancy Dress and Bushcraft Cookery School Day. Prompt 08.30 arrival is essential so we can catch the 09.00 ferry. Don't be late!
For this 3-day woodland bonanza, make sure you wear old clothes and trainers. You'll be getting muddy - that's a given! You'll also need a packed lunch, warm layers, a waterproof jacket and refillable water bottle.
ADVENTURE TEENS
This adventurous week is a step up from the regular Kids Club - perfect for teens looking to do more:
Two days will focus on advanced Bushcraft skills; using knives, campfire cookery and activities such as axe throwing and archery. Two days will be spent in the water paddle boarding and kayaking, practicing skills that will culminate in an epic Kayak journey out to Old Harry Rocks. The remaining day will be spent clambering, climbing and jumping in a mega Coasteering adventure along the Jurassic Coast.
All of these activities will be subject to change due to weather- we'll always choose the safest AND most fun activity for your teens!
Our Summer programmes are heavily water-based, so we recommend your children are confident in the water and can swim. If your child is joining a summer Kids Club that includes Coasteering, they must be able to swim at least 25 metres and be confident in the sea and moving water. If your child cannot swim, then they will repeat a dry activity such as bushcraft.
